Transaction 10650336df79bab190b510e9802b457fdbf686566d7033ecec302a176c341250
1 Input
1 Output
-
10650336df79bab190b510e9802b457fdbf686566d7033ecec302a176c341250:0
- value
- 69837
- script pubkey
- OP_0 OP_PUSHBYTES_20 23133695446a6b002d35b1e7c44ad1d0c9d8fc71
- address
- bc1qyvfnd92ydf4sqtf4k8nugjk36rya3lr36s6t7f